Designed with precision, this SPD is engineered to handle demanding conditions while ensuring optimal protection for your equipment.</p><p>Operating at a rated voltage of 230 VAC, this device efficiently manages surge currents with a capacity of 50 kA between line and neutral (L-N), and 25 kA from neutral to protective earth (N-PE). This makes it suitable for three-phase systems where reliability is paramount. The LED display provides clear indicators of power status and thermal failure, allowing for quick diagnostics without complicated procedures.</p><p>Installation is straightforward thanks to its shunt connection type and TS35 DIN rail mounting system. With dimensions of 70 mm in width, 54 mm in height, and 95 mm in depth, it fits seamlessly into existing setups without consuming excessive space. Despite its compact size, the device boasts an IP20 degree of protection, ensuring safety against solid objects larger than 12 mm.</p><p>Constructed from durable aluminium material weighing just 390 g, the SPD withstands operational temperatures ranging from -40 to 70 degrees Celsius. Its ability to perform under varied environmental conditions is further supported by compliance with rigorous standards such as IEC 61643-11:2011, AS/NZS 1768:2007, IEEE 62.41.2:2002, and UL 1449 Third Edition.</p><p>The SPD&#39;s response time is impressively fast at less than 100 nanoseconds between N-PE connections—critical for minimizing downtime during unexpected surges.
